Review | MERMAID FOREST, (Manga Video), 56 mins, cert 18, £8.99 MERMAID FOREST, (US Manga Corps), 55 mins, subtitled, $35, unrated. Rumiko Takahashi's manga story was based on Japanese legends, in which eating the flesh of a mermaid can confer eternal life - at the price of making eternal life a lonely hell. A gory tale of sudden death, gruesome medical experiments, and long meditated revenge; this isn't explicit by our splatter standards but rather, on a first viewing it works on the imagination to produce a strong frisson of horror in the way that the best horror movies do. Manga Video's low-priced mass-market version uses a rather freer translation than the American subtitles, and though the dubbing sounds a litle flat, it's quite accept- able. Definitely one of Manga Video's better offerings. |
